When we think about social entrepreneurs & social entrepreneurship, it’s about an individually motivated organization that is being setup.

Community led social enterprises are led and managed by the community in which the enterprise is based.

Members of the community, to get them involved and to work with the community so that the community identifies what it wants to achieve and sets up an organization and processes and practices that will enable community to be consistently involved in the way that organization is set up and managed. That is, there is close engagement between community and organization.
